Conditional Use Permit, Franklin Outdoor Advertising: Chair Fredrickson called the hearing to order to
which Weyrens stated the purpose of the hearing is to consider a Conditional Use Permit (CUP) to allow
for roof -mounted solar panels on the house located at 9115 Cayley Ct in the River Ridge Estates
subdivision. The property is located in the Residential R-10 District within St. Joseph Township, and in
the Orderly Annexation Area. Roof -mounted solar panels are a permitted accessory use under the
Stearns County Land Use and Zoning Ordinance. The Memorandum of Understanding between the City
and Township of St. Joseph requires a conditional use permit for solar energy systems. Therefore, in the
strict interpretation, roof mounted solar panels would require a conditional use permit as it does not
differentiate between building or roof -mounted solar panels, free-standing solar arrays, solar gardens and
solar farms.
Isaac Lindstrom, All Energy Solar, approached the Board on behalf of his client, Corey Linn. Lindstrom
stated the proposed project is the first 15.12 KW in the area for a residential property. The structures will
be located on the rear roof, which is facing the Sauk River. The proposed solar structures meet all the
setback requirements.

Hausmann made a motion authoring execution of the CUP Findings of Fact and Decision; issuing
a CUP to Corey Linn, 9115 Cayley Ct, to install two roof mounted solar array panels with the
following contingencies. The motion was passed unanimously by those present:
1. The applicant/property owner is responsible for meeting all Federal, State, and Local
requirements, including but not limited to meeting the Stearns County Land Use and
Zoning Ordinance, MN State Building Code, and the MN State Electric Code and
obtaining any and all permits and licenses.
2. A building permit must be obtained prior to the installation of the solar energy system.
3. The solar energy system shall not be used for the display of advertising.
4. Utility Notification: The electric utility service provider that serves the Subject Property
shall be informed of the applicant's intent to install the solar energy system if the
applicant intends to connect to the electricity grid and such documentation shall be
submitted to the City of St. Joseph. If the applicant does not plan to connect the system
to the utility service electricity grid, the applicant shall declare so in writing in the building
permit application.
5. Revocation: The Joint Planning Board shall revoke the conditional use permit if it
determines that the terms and conditions of the permit as issued are no longer being
complied with. A certified copy of an order of the Joint Planning Board revoking the
interim use permit shall be filed with the County Recorder for recording.
6. Expiration: If within one (1) year after issuance of granting a conditional use permit the
use permitted has not started, then the permit is null and void, unless the Joint Planning

Board has approved a petition for an extension. The conditional use permit shall expire if
the authorized use ceases for any reason for more than one (1) year.
All abandoned or unused solar energy systems/solar panels shall be removed within
twelve (12) months of the cessation of operation.
The St. Joseph City Administrator and/or his/her designee shall have the right to inspect
the Subject Property for compliance and safety purposes annually or at any time upon
reasonable request.
